  • Patent number: 6296464
    Abstract: The invention relates to a calibrating device with at least one calibrating die (24), which has die faces (66) against which an extruded object fed therethrough is applied, in particular a section having several cavities, a sealing device (60, 62) being provided to seal off a gap (56) in order to form a cavity (59) and, having been formed, this cavity (59) is evacuated to a negative pressure lower than the ambient pressure, means being provided to form the gap (56) before the first end face (53) of the calibrating die (24) and at least one of the terminal edges (67) of the die faces (66) having part end faces (76) to form the gap (56) with a gap width (65) smaller than 1.0 mm.

  • Patent number: 6066288
    Abstract: A method for cooling and if necessary calibrating elongate articles 7 of plastic, in which the article 7, during its continuous progress has flowing round it only a gaseous cooling medium 42 at a temperature of less than 100.degree. C. at least over a portion of its outer surface and extending over a pre-determinable length of the article 7, in a plurality of flow areas 25-35' separate from one another and located one behind the other in the extrusion direction, arrow 5.

  • Patent number: 5514325
    Abstract: The invention describes a process for cooling and if necessary calibrating elongated, especially continuously extruded objects (7) made of plastic as well as a cooling and calibrating device (5) for carrying out the process. With this the object (7) during its advancement in the longitudinal direction is exposed in consecutive regions (13 to 18; 86 to 89, 95 to 97) to a higher vacuum in each case and is cooled with respect to the initial temperature to a lower final temperature. The heat to be removed for cooling is extracted by a coolant washing round the object (7).

  • Patent number: 5186876
    Abstract: A dimensionally stable plastics section, for example a window section, formed from a plastics extrudate and being provided thereon with an extruded layer, for example a sealing or damping device or a protective strip, is manufactured by extruding the section, calibrating it, and cooling it to ensure its dimensional stability, heating part of the surface of the section, to which the layer is to be applied, extruding the layer onto the heated part of the surface of the section so that the extruded layer is bonded thereto and using a take-up device to grip the finished section to remove it.

  • Patent number: 4685879
    Abstract: The calibrator for plate like extruded products, particularly a wall section composed of a plastic, comprises an upper portion, a lower portion connected to the upper portion and a gap for the extruded material formed between them, the upper and lower portions being pivotally connected on one side by a pivot member. To allow a rapid and easy closing and opening of this calibrator a pivoting member pivotally attached to these portions and positioned for locking of the upper with the lower portion is provided. Further in the calibrator a cooling means through which a cooling medium, for example water, flows is provided. For even more efficient cooling a snake like channel for the cooling medium running transverse to the extrusion direction is provided. Both the above features can be employed independently of each other or used jointly.
